java中如果将数字转字符串

在Java中,将数字转换为字符串其实非常简单,有多种方法可供选择。直接定义的话,比如:String str = "1234";如果1234是你返回的一个对象的值,那么使用像这样:Integer i = 1234; i.toString();同样也能将其转换为字符串。当然,根据具体的应用场景,选择不同的方法会更加合适。例如,如果数字存储...
java中如果将数字转字符串
在Java中,将数字转换为字符串其实非常简单,有多种方法可供选择。直接定义的话,比如:

String str = "1234";

如果1234是你返回的一个对象的值,那么使用像这样:

Integer i = 1234; i.toString();

同样也能将其转换为字符串。当然,根据具体的应用场景,选择不同的方法会更加合适。例如,如果数字存储在一个int类型的变量中,可以使用Integer.valueOf()方法将它转换为Integer对象,然后调用toString()方法:

int num = 1234; String str = Integer.toString(num);

此外,还可以利用String类的构造函数直接将数字转换为字符串:

int num = 1234; String str = new String(Integer.toString(num));

或者使用String.valueOf()方法:

int num = 1234; String str = String.valueOf(num);

以上方法在实际应用中都非常常见,选择合适的方法可以提高代码的可读性和效率。根据具体需求,选择最恰当的方法进行转换。

在进行数字转换时,还需要注意不同数据类型的转换,比如long、double等。例如,将long类型的数字转换为字符串:

long num = 123456789L; String str = Long.toString(num);

或者将double类型的数字转换为字符串:

double num = 1234.56; String str = Double.toString(num);

总之,根据实际应用场景,灵活选择合适的转换方法是非常重要的。2024-12-25
mengvlog 阅读 116 次 更新于 2025-09-09 23:55:08 我来答关注问题0
  •  翡希信息咨询 java中数字转换成指定的字符串要怎么转

    使用String.format方法:String.format方法允许你使用格式化字符串来指定数字的格式。例如,String.format会将整数num格式化为一个至少3位的字符串,不足部分用0填充。代码示例:javaint num = 1;String str = String.format;System.out.println; // 输出 "001"2. 使用String.valueOf方法: String.va...

  •  阿暄生活 java从excel单元格读取数字并转换为字符串的函数

    首先,通过FileInputStream和XSSFWorkbook类打开Excel文件。然后,获取第一个工作表(Sheet),并遍历每一行(Row)。对于每一行的目标列(假设目标数字在第一列),检查单元格类型是否为NUMERIC。如果是,使用cell.getNumericCellValue()方法读取数字值,并使用String.valueOf()方法将其转换为字符串。二、处...

  •  誉祥祥知识 java怎么把数字转换成字符串

    将数字转换为字符串,是编程中常见的需求之一。在Java中,有多种方法可以实现这一转换。最简单直接的方法是使用字符串相加的方式,比如:"" + 124。这种方式简单快捷,适用于大多数情况。另一种方法是利用String类提供的API,即String.valueOf(1243.44)。这种方法不仅适用于整数,也适用于浮点数。通过...

  • 在Java中,将数字转换为字符串其实非常简单,有多种方法可供选择。直接定义的话,比如:String str = "1234";如果1234是你返回的一个对象的值,那么使用像这样:Integer i = 1234; i.toString();同样也能将其转换为字符串。当然,根据具体的应用场景,选择不同的方法会更加合适。例如,如果数字存储...

  •  深空见闻 java数字转字符串支持哪些进制

    在Java中,将数字转换为字符串并支持不同的进制,可以通过以下几种方式实现:二进制:使用Integer.toBinaryString(int i)方法,可以将整数i转换为二进制字符串。例如,Integer.toBinaryString(5)将返回"101"。八进制:使用Integer.toOctalString(int i)方法,可以将整数i转换为八进制字符串。

檬味博客在线解答立即免费咨询

Java相关话题

Copyright © 2023 WWW.MENGVLOG.COM - 檬味博客
返回顶部